Our Sewer Camera Inspection Process

Here is how we handle every sewer camera inspection project in San Juan.

1

Access & Camera Setup

Our San Juan technician locates the best access point for the camera — usually a cleanout or main drain — and prepares the equipment for a complete inspection of your sewer system.

2

Full Line Inspection

Scranton Sewer Authority inspects your entire San Juan sewer line with an HD camera, recording footage and noting the precise location of every issue. We measure distances and mark above-ground locations for future reference.

3

Findings Review

We review the camera footage with you, explaining what each finding means and how it affects your sewer line function. You see the evidence and understand the situation before any decisions are made.

4

Written Report & Recommendations

Our San Juan crew provides a written inspection report with findings, photos, and prioritized recommendations. This documentation is invaluable for real estate transactions, insurance claims, and repair planning.

How much does a sewer camera inspection cost in San Juan, TX?

Sewer camera inspections in San Juan typically cost $150 to $400 depending on pipe length and accessibility. Scranton Sewer Authority includes a free camera inspection with most major service calls. Standalone inspections for home purchases or maintenance checks are available at competitive rates.

Do I get to see the camera footage in San Juan?

Absolutely. Scranton Sewer Authority shows you the live camera feed during the inspection and provides recorded footage with your written report. We walk you through every finding so you understand the condition of your San Juan sewer line completely.

When should I get a sewer camera inspection in San Juan?

We recommend a camera inspection when buying a home in San Juan, when you have recurring drain problems, before a major renovation, or every 2 to 3 years for preventive maintenance. Older homes with clay or cast iron pipes should be inspected more frequently.

How accurate is sewer camera location mapping in San Juan?

Scranton Sewer Authority uses sonde locating technology with our cameras in San Juan. This radio transmitter allows us to mark the above-ground location of any defect with accuracy within inches — critical information for planning targeted repairs.
